Official Replacement and Repair Services
Sony continues to provide official support for the Dualsense Edge. In 2026, authorized service centers offer:
- Component replacements, including joysticks and triggers
- Battery replacements for extended gameplay
- Full controller repairs for hardware issues
To access these services, users should contact Sony’s official support channels or visit authorized repair centers. It is recommended to keep proof of purchase for warranty claims.
Third-Party Repair Options
Many third-party companies specialize in repairing gaming controllers, including the Dualsense Edge. In 2026, these options can be cost-effective and offer quick turnaround times. However, users should consider:
- Verifying the reputation of the repair service
- Ensuring the use of genuine or high-quality replacement parts
- Understanding warranty implications for third-party repairs
Choosing a reputable repair service can help maintain the controller’s performance and longevity.
DIY Repair Tips for 2026
For tech-savvy users, DIY repairs are still an option in 2026. Essential tips include:
- Using official repair guides or tutorials from trusted sources
- Employing proper tools such as precision screwdrivers and spudgers
- Handling internal components with anti-static precautions
Note that DIY repairs can void warranties, so weigh this risk before proceeding.
